CSS 括號的使用是 CSS 樣式表中非常重要的一部分,用于指定樣式規則和屬性值。不同的瀏覽器和開發者工具對 CSS 括號的使用方式略有不同,以下是一些常見的 CSS 括號用法和注意事項:
1. 類名和屬性名的括號
在類名和屬性名之間使用 CSS 括號可以定義一個類或屬性。例如:
```css
.my-class {
color: blue;
font-size: 16px;
在這個例子中,`.my-class` 是一個類名,`color` 是一個屬性名,它們之間使用 CSS 括號。
2. 嵌套樣式的括號
嵌套樣式可以使用 CSS 括號來定義子元素或類中的樣式。例如:
```css
color: blue;
.my-class {
h1 {
color: red;
在這個例子中,`.my-class` 是一個嵌套的類,它定義了一個子類 `h1`,這個子類繼承了父類的樣式,并使用了 `color` 屬性。
3. 變量的括號
在 CSS 中,可以使用變量來定義樣式。例如:
```css
background-color: #f00;
#variable {
background-color: #900;
在這個例子中,`background-color` 屬性的值被定義為了 `#f00`,然后使用 `#variable` 變量來修改這個值。
4. 正則表達式的括號
使用正則表達式來定義 CSS 樣式也可以使用 CSS 括號。例如:
```css
:root {
--color: red;
--font-size: 18px;
/* 正則表達式 */
:root {
color: green:red(?!yellow);
font-size: 24px;
在這個例子中,`:root` 元素被定義為了 `red` 和 `:red(?!yellow)` 兩個樣式。`:red` 和 `:green` 是正則表達式,它們定義了 `color` 和 `font-size` 屬性的值。
CSS 括號是 CSS 樣式表中非常重要的一部分,它們用于定義各種樣式規則和屬性值。正確地使用 CSS 括號可以使代碼更加清晰和易于理解。